Bridgestone on course for 2005 gains

April 28, 2005

Bridgestone Corp. expects its net sales to reach $24 billion in 2005, says Bridgestone Americas Holding Inc. Chairman and CEO Mark Emkes.

Bridgestone Corp.'s net sales in 2004 totaled $23 billion.

Bridgestone Americas Holding posted $9.15 billion in net sales last year, according to Emkes, who says that parent company Bridgestone Corp. "remains fully committed" to the subsidiary.

Emkes credits the tiremakers' growth in the Americas to passenger and light truck tire sales increases and "strong performance in sales of truck and bus tires. We also recorded significant brand and product mix improvements."
